Total Liabilities for Norwegian Cruise Line (NCLH)
According to Norwegian Cruise Line's latest reported financial statements, the company's latest reported total liabilities is $20.33B USD. Total liabilities sum everything the company owes at the end of each reporting period — accounts payable, accrued expenses, debt, lease obligations, and other claims — as filed on the balance sheet. Total Liabilities history chart for Norwegian Cruise Line (NCLH) from 2004 to 2025
Total Liabilities history table for Norwegian Cruise Line (NCLH) from 2004 to 2025
| Fiscal year | Period ended | Reported | Total Liabilities | YoY |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2025 | $20.33B | +9.6% | ||
| 2024 | $18.54B | -3.4% | ||
| 2023 | $19.19B | +3.8% | ||
| 2022 | $18.49B | +13.4% | ||
| 2021 | $16.30B | +16.0% | ||
| 2020 | $14.05B | +38.1% | ||
| 2019 | $10.17B | +10.0% | ||
| 2018 | $9.24B | +10.8% | ||
| 2017 | $8.35B | -1.1% | ||
| 2016 | $8.44B | -0.6% | ||
| 2015 | $8.48B | +5.2% | ||
| 2014 | $8.06B | +100.6% | ||
| 2013 | $4.02B | +2.6% | ||
| 2012 | $3.92B | +5.4% | ||
| 2011 | $3.72B | -3.0% | ||
| 2010 | $3.83B | +23.3% | ||
| 2009 | $3.11B | -11.2% | ||
| 2008 | $3.50B | -7.9% | ||
| 2007 | $3.80B | +19.6% | ||
| 2006 | $3.17B | +21.9% | ||
| 2005 | $2.60B | +23.4% | ||
| 2004 | $2.11B | — |
Total Liabilities values are taken from Norwegian Cruise Line's reported balance sheets (10-Q quarterly and 10-K annual filings with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ission). Each row shows the period end date and the date the filing was reported; YoY compares each figure to the same period one year earlier. Amounts are in USD as filed.
